WWE Royal Rumble 2012: Who Was the Best Rumble Winner on January 19th?

Chris HumphreyJan 19, 2012

Unlike my first article, I found that January 19th has been a very busy day for the Royal Rumble over the years. Four events have taken place in the 24-year history of the event, with pay-per-views in 1991, 1992, 1997 and 2003.

With four separate Rumble winners from the past two decades, which of those superstars had the most impressive victory in the WWE's first stop on the road to WrestleMania in the spring?

Royal Rumble 1991: Hulk Hogan

1 of 5

After winning the Royal Rumble from the No. 25 draw the year before, Hulk Hogan entered the 1991 match one draw earlier at No. 24 and went on to become the first of three superstars to win more than one Rumble during a superstar's career in the WWE.

Royal Rumble 1992: Ric Flair

2 of 5

In the fifth edition of the Royal Rumble, the Nature Boy survived the match after entering the match with the No. 3 draw. Flair, with the help of Hulk Hogan from the outside, eliminated Sid Vicious to become the only superstar to win the Rumble to become the new WWE Champion in 1992.

Royal Rumble 1997: Stone Cold Steve Austin

3 of 5

Even though it was a tainted Rattlesnake victory in the 1997 Royal Rumble, Steve Austin's performance was one of the best in the history of the Rumble. Stone Cold entered the match with the No. 5 draw and eliminated a then record-tying 10 superstars, shared by Hulk Hogan before the mark was broken by Kane in the 2001 Royal Rumble.

Royal Rumble 2003: Brock Lesnar

4 of 5

In the final Royal Rumble event to take place on January 19th through the years, Brock Lesnar won the 2003 Rumble later than any of the other three superstars before him, at No. 29. The "Next Big Thing" went on to defeat Kurt Angle at WrestleMania XIX to become WWE Champion for a second time.

Who Was the Best Royal Rumble Winner of Those Four Years?

5 of 5

So, out of the four superstars who claimed their place in Royal Rumble history over the years, who do you think was the best Rumble winner between Hulk Hogan, Ric Flair, Stone Cold Steve Austin or Brock Lesnar?
